CA2209083A1 - Method and apparatus for decoding an encoded signal - Google Patents
Method and apparatus for decoding an encoded signalInfo
- Publication number
- CA2209083A1 CA2209083A1 CA002209083A CA2209083A CA2209083A1 CA 2209083 A1 CA2209083 A1 CA 2209083A1 CA 002209083 A CA002209083 A CA 002209083A CA 2209083 A CA2209083 A CA 2209083A CA 2209083 A1 CA2209083 A1 CA 2209083A1
- Authority
- CA
- Canada
- Prior art keywords
- receiver
- bits
- decoding
- values
- encoded signal
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Granted
Links
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L27/00—Modulated-carrier systems
- H04L27/02—Amplitude-modulated carrier systems, e.g. using on-off keying; Single sideband or vestigial sideband modulation
- H04L27/06—Demodulator circuits; Receiver circuits
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L1/00—Arrangements for detecting or preventing errors in the information received
- H04L1/004—Arrangements for detecting or preventing errors in the information received by using forward error control
- H04L1/0056—Systems characterized by the type of code used
- H04L1/0059—Convolutional codes
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L25/00—Baseband systems
- H04L25/02—Details ; arrangements for supplying electrical power along data transmission lines
- H04L25/03—Shaping networks in transmitter or receiver, e.g. adaptive shaping networks
- H04L25/03006—Arrangements for removing intersymbol interference
- H04L25/03178—Arrangements involving sequence estimation techniques
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L27/00—Modulated-carrier systems
- H04L27/10—Frequency-modulated carrier systems, i.e. using frequency-shift keying
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L27/00—Modulated-carrier systems
- H04L27/10—Frequency-modulated carrier systems, i.e. using frequency-shift keying
- H04L27/103—Chirp modulation
Abstract
A decoder (215) implemented in a receiver of a wireless communication system employs an improved method and apparatus for decoding an encoded signal. The receiver sums the energy values (156A, 156B,...156N) from a plurality of fingers within to produce an aggregate energy value (166). From the aggregate energy value (166), a set of log-likelihood values (207) are generated with a non-linear function generator (205) before being deinterleaved by a deinterleaver (210). The deinterleaved values (213) are input to the decoder (215) which estimates the original signal (178) by incorporating path histories of bits in the estimation of subsequent, related bits. Use of the path histories of bits improves the estimates of the original signal (178), which translates into an increase in the sensitivity of the receiver.
Applications Claiming Priority (3)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US08/581,696 US5862190A (en) | 1995-12-29 | 1995-12-29 | Method and apparatus for decoding an encoded signal |
US08/581,696 | 1995-12-29 | ||
PCT/US1996/016141 WO1997024850A1 (en) | 1995-12-29 | 1996-10-09 | Method and apparatus for decoding an encoded signal |
Publications (2)
Publication Number | Publication Date |
---|---|
CA2209083A1 true CA2209083A1 (en) | 1997-06-29 |
CA2209083C CA2209083C (en) | 2002-01-08 |
Family
ID=24326209
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
CA002209083A Expired - Fee Related CA2209083C (en) | 1995-12-29 | 1996-10-09 | Method and apparatus for decoding an encoded signal |
Country Status (13)
Country | Link |
---|---|
US (1) | US5862190A (en) |
JP (1) | JP3569288B2 (en) |
KR (1) | KR100231291B1 (en) |
CN (1) | CN1099179C (en) |
BR (1) | BR9607430A (en) |
CA (1) | CA2209083C (en) |
DE (1) | DE19681214T1 (en) |
FI (1) | FI973535A0 (en) |
FR (1) | FR2743229B1 (en) |
GB (1) | GB2312816B (en) |
IL (1) | IL119422A (en) |
SE (1) | SE521498C2 (en) |
WO (1) | WO1997024850A1 (en) |
Families Citing this family (31)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US6788708B1 (en) * | 1997-03-30 | 2004-09-07 | Intel Corporation | Code synchronization unit and method |
US6075824A (en) * | 1997-08-04 | 2000-06-13 | Motorola, Inc. | Method and apparatus for re-encoding decoded data |
US6018546A (en) * | 1997-09-16 | 2000-01-25 | Lucent Technologies Inc. | Technique for soft decision metric generation in a wireless communications system |
US6094739A (en) * | 1997-09-24 | 2000-07-25 | Lucent Technologies, Inc. | Trellis decoder for real-time video rate decoding and de-interleaving |
US6233271B1 (en) * | 1997-12-31 | 2001-05-15 | Sony Corporation | Method and apparatus for decoding trellis coded direct sequence spread spectrum communication signals |
US6215813B1 (en) * | 1997-12-31 | 2001-04-10 | Sony Corporation | Method and apparatus for encoding trellis coded direct sequence spread spectrum communication signals |
US5974079A (en) * | 1998-01-26 | 1999-10-26 | Motorola, Inc. | Method and apparatus for encoding rate determination in a communication system |
US6334202B1 (en) * | 1998-07-22 | 2001-12-25 | Telefonaktiebolaget Lm Ericsson (Publ) | Fast metric calculation for Viterbi decoder implementation |
US6381728B1 (en) | 1998-08-14 | 2002-04-30 | Qualcomm Incorporated | Partitioned interleaver memory for map decoder |
ES2347309T3 (en) * | 1998-08-14 | 2010-10-27 | Qualcomm Incorporated | MEMORY ARCHITECTURE FOR POSTIORIOR MAXIMUM PROBABILITY DECODER. |
US6434203B1 (en) | 1999-02-26 | 2002-08-13 | Qualcomm, Incorporated | Memory architecture for map decoder |
US6556634B1 (en) | 1999-02-10 | 2003-04-29 | Ericsson, Inc. | Maximum likelihood rake receiver for use in a code division, multiple access wireless communication system |
US6480552B1 (en) * | 1999-03-24 | 2002-11-12 | Lucent Technologies Inc. | Soft output metrics generation for symbol detectors |
US6754290B1 (en) * | 1999-03-31 | 2004-06-22 | Qualcomm Incorporated | Highly parallel map decoder |
US6587519B1 (en) * | 1999-05-28 | 2003-07-01 | Koninklijke Philips Electronics N.V. | Efficient apparatus and method for generating a trellis code from a shared state counter |
WO2001020799A1 (en) * | 1999-09-13 | 2001-03-22 | Sony Electronics, Inc. | Method and apparatus for decoding trellis coded direct sequence spread spectrum communication signals |
US6700938B1 (en) * | 1999-09-29 | 2004-03-02 | Motorola, Inc. | Method for determining quality of trellis decoded block data |
JP3259725B2 (en) * | 1999-12-20 | 2002-02-25 | 日本電気株式会社 | Viterbi decoding device |
JP2001352256A (en) * | 2000-06-08 | 2001-12-21 | Sony Corp | Decoder and decoding method |
US6834088B2 (en) * | 2001-03-12 | 2004-12-21 | Motorola, Inc. | Method and apparatus for calculating bit log-likelihood ratios for QAM signals |
CN1110163C (en) * | 2001-04-16 | 2003-05-28 | 华为技术有限公司 | Estimating method for flat fading channel in CDMA communication system and its device |
US7315576B1 (en) * | 2002-02-05 | 2008-01-01 | Qualcomm Incorporated | System for soft symbol decoding with MIMO log-map detection |
US7272118B1 (en) * | 2002-02-06 | 2007-09-18 | Sprint Spectrum L.P. | Method and system for selecting vocoder rates and transmit powers for air interface communications |
US7555584B2 (en) * | 2004-09-29 | 2009-06-30 | Intel Corporation | Providing additional channels for an MSL architecture |
KR100595688B1 (en) * | 2004-11-03 | 2006-07-03 | 엘지전자 주식회사 | Method for cell reselection in mobile communication device |
US7555071B2 (en) * | 2005-09-29 | 2009-06-30 | Agere Systems Inc. | Method and apparatus for non-linear scaling of log likelihood ratio (LLR) values in a decoder |
CN101465974B (en) * | 2007-12-21 | 2010-11-03 | 卓胜微电子(上海)有限公司 | Method for implementing encode of nonlinear code |
US8140107B1 (en) | 2008-01-04 | 2012-03-20 | Sprint Spectrum L.P. | Method and system for selective power control of wireless coverage areas |
US8750418B2 (en) * | 2008-05-09 | 2014-06-10 | Marvell World Trade Ltd. | Symbol vector-level combining transmitter for incremental redundancy HARQ with MIMO |
US10333561B2 (en) * | 2015-01-26 | 2019-06-25 | Northrop Grumman Systems Corporation | Iterative equalization using non-linear models in a soft-input soft-output trellis |
CN113973037A (en) * | 2020-07-24 | 2022-01-25 | 晶晨半导体(上海)股份有限公司 | Demodulation method, apparatus, device and computer readable storage medium |
Family Cites Families (14)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4945549A (en) * | 1986-11-13 | 1990-07-31 | The United States Of America As Represented By The Administrator Of The National Aeronautics And Space Administration | Trellis coded modulation for transmission over fading mobile satellite channel |
US5134635A (en) * | 1990-07-30 | 1992-07-28 | Motorola, Inc. | Convolutional decoder using soft-decision decoding with channel state information |
DE4024106C1 (en) * | 1990-07-30 | 1992-04-23 | Ethicon Gmbh & Co Kg, 2000 Norderstedt, De | |
SG44761A1 (en) * | 1991-01-09 | 1997-12-19 | Philips Electronics Uk Ltd | Signal transmission system |
US5233629A (en) * | 1991-07-26 | 1993-08-03 | General Instrument Corporation | Method and apparatus for communicating digital data using trellis coded qam |
US5204874A (en) * | 1991-08-28 | 1993-04-20 | Motorola, Inc. | Method and apparatus for using orthogonal coding in a communication system |
US5159608A (en) * | 1991-08-28 | 1992-10-27 | Falconer David D | Method and apparatus for using orthogonal coding in a communication system |
US5442627A (en) * | 1993-06-24 | 1995-08-15 | Qualcomm Incorporated | Noncoherent receiver employing a dual-maxima metric generation process |
US5414738A (en) * | 1993-11-09 | 1995-05-09 | Motorola, Inc. | Maximum likelihood paths comparison decoder |
US5502713A (en) * | 1993-12-07 | 1996-03-26 | Telefonaktiebolaget Lm Ericsson | Soft error concealment in a TDMA radio system |
US5608763A (en) * | 1993-12-30 | 1997-03-04 | Motorola, Inc. | Method and apparatus for decoding a radio frequency signal containing a sequence of phase values |
US5511096A (en) * | 1994-01-18 | 1996-04-23 | Gi Corporation | Quadrature amplitude modulated data for standard bandwidth television channel |
US5583889A (en) * | 1994-07-08 | 1996-12-10 | Zenith Electronics Corporation | Trellis coded modulation system for HDTV |
US5450453A (en) * | 1994-09-28 | 1995-09-12 | Motorola, Inc. | Method, apparatus and system for decoding a non-coherently demodulated signal |
-
1995
- 1995-12-29 US US08/581,696 patent/US5862190A/en not_active Expired - Fee Related
-
1996
- 1996-10-09 CN CN96192248A patent/CN1099179C/en not_active Expired - Fee Related
- 1996-10-09 CA CA002209083A patent/CA2209083C/en not_active Expired - Fee Related
- 1996-10-09 DE DE19681214T patent/DE19681214T1/en not_active Ceased
- 1996-10-09 GB GB9716330A patent/GB2312816B/en not_active Expired - Fee Related
- 1996-10-09 JP JP52431397A patent/JP3569288B2/en not_active Expired - Fee Related
- 1996-10-09 BR BR9607430A patent/BR9607430A/en not_active Application Discontinuation
- 1996-10-09 WO PCT/US1996/016141 patent/WO1997024850A1/en active IP Right Grant
- 1996-10-09 KR KR1019970705996A patent/KR100231291B1/en not_active IP Right Cessation
- 1996-10-14 IL IL11942296A patent/IL119422A/en not_active IP Right Cessation
- 1996-11-27 FR FR9614519A patent/FR2743229B1/en not_active Expired - Fee Related
-
1997
- 1997-08-27 FI FI973535A patent/FI973535A0/en not_active Application Discontinuation
- 1997-08-28 SE SE9703096A patent/SE521498C2/en not_active IP Right Cessation
Also Published As
Publication number | Publication date |
---|---|
CN1099179C (en) | 2003-01-15 |
FI973535A (en) | 1997-08-27 |
DE19681214T1 (en) | 1999-07-15 |
KR100231291B1 (en) | 1999-11-15 |
US5862190A (en) | 1999-01-19 |
IL119422A0 (en) | 1997-01-10 |
GB2312816A (en) | 1997-11-05 |
IL119422A (en) | 2005-08-31 |
WO1997024850A1 (en) | 1997-07-10 |
BR9607430A (en) | 1998-05-26 |
CA2209083C (en) | 2002-01-08 |
FR2743229A1 (en) | 1997-07-04 |
FI973535A0 (en) | 1997-08-27 |
GB2312816B (en) | 2000-05-10 |
FR2743229B1 (en) | 2001-07-27 |
GB9716330D0 (en) | 1997-10-08 |
JPH11501492A (en) | 1999-02-02 |
SE9703096D0 (en) | 1997-08-28 |
JP3569288B2 (en) | 2004-09-22 |
SE9703096L (en) | 1997-10-29 |
KR19980702590A (en) | 1998-07-15 |
CN1176722A (en) | 1998-03-18 |
SE521498C2 (en) | 2003-11-04 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
CA2209083A1 (en) | Method and apparatus for decoding an encoded signal | |
CA2252664A1 (en) | Method and apparatus for data transmission using multiple transmit antennas | |
EP2325839A1 (en) | Data embedding system | |
CA2165801A1 (en) | Receiver for a Direct Sequence Spread Spectrum Orthogonally Encoded Signal Employing Rake Principle | |
CA2090513A1 (en) | Method and apparatus for providing antenna diversity | |
RU97103217A (en) | METHOD AND DEVICE FOR SUPPRESSING INTERFERENCE IN MULTI-ANTENNA DIGITAL CELLULAR COMMUNICATION SYSTEMS | |
EP0727890A3 (en) | Method and device for the reception of signals affected by inter-symbol interference | |
CA2157069A1 (en) | Adaptive Forward Error Correction System | |
WO2002015502A3 (en) | Adaptive linear equalisation for walsh-modulated | |
CA2131535A1 (en) | Method and Apparatus of Adaptive Maximum Likelihood Sequence Estimation Using a Variable Convergence Step Size | |
WO2001076094A3 (en) | Space-time code for multiple antenna transmission | |
WO1997039550A3 (en) | Equalizer with a sequence estimation method with state reduction for a receiver in a digital transmission system | |
WO1996011533A3 (en) | Signal detection in a tdma system | |
CA2239129A1 (en) | Data transmission system, receiver, and recording medium | |
CA2108494A1 (en) | A frequency hopping code division multiple access radio communication unit | |
WO2002009315A1 (en) | Receiving apparatus and receiving method for radio communication | |
AU2001237489A1 (en) | Method and device for estimating channel propagation | |
AU2042599A (en) | Line driver with linear transitions | |
WO2001069789A3 (en) | Optimized turbo decoder | |
EP0833478A3 (en) | Pattern matching apparatus | |
CA2173880A1 (en) | Apparatus and Methods for Decoding a Communication Signal | |
TW349297B (en) | Serial data transmission apparatus | |
EP2271039B1 (en) | Process and arrangement for turbo equalization with turbo decoding of signals | |
WO2004100436A3 (en) | Method and apparatus for facilitating efficient deinterleaving and diversity-combining of a data signal | |
JP2003348057A (en) | Radio transmitter, radio transmission system, radio receiver and program for the same |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
EEER | Examination request | ||
MKLA | Lapsed | ||
MKLA | Lapsed |
Effective date: 20081009 |